Pokémon Gold and Silver introduce:
- 101 new Pokémon to the game
- A day and night system
- Days of the week
- A phone
- A radio
- Colour
- Many new moves
- The dark and steel type of Pokémon
- A Pokégear (with a built in map)
- Roaming Pokémon e.g Suicune
- Decorating your room
- Hold items
- Evolution by holding an item
- Clocks
- Registered Items
- Printing (from the Game Boy Printer)
- Lottery Corner
- Apricorns (can be used to make special Poké Balls)
- Pockets in the bag
- Pokémon Eggs
- Mystery Gift (via infra-red)
- Shiny Pokémon
- Pokérus
New features in Crystal include:
- Animated Pokémon graphics
- A choice of boy or girl
- New Suicune quest
- New Ruins of Alph quest
- A new Battle Tower located west of Olivine City
- New ways to get Ho-oh and Lugia
- Features Suicune (Gold features Ho-oh and Silver features Lugia)
- Many Pokémon have move changes
- Daycare lady gives you an Odd Egg, Pokémon in it has a special move as well as a 50% chance of being shiny
- When you enter a certain area, a sign will appear at the bottom of the screen telling you where you are
- New Mobile Adapter (only for Japanese version)
- A way to get Celebi using the GS Ball (only for Japanese version)
- Features the very first Move tutors
- New function in the PokéGear called Buena's Password
- Trainer's calls are now more detailed, and won't always ask to battle
- Some trainers will give you evolution stones for free if they call you
- A new Pokémon Seer appears in Cianwood City
- In-game trades has been changed
- Graphics in caves has been updated, Ice Cave and Dragon's Den's graphics have been updated quite a bit
